Mod Launcher
Hi, I noticed that the launcher (on steam) does not respect your mod order once a new mod is inserted, even with a saved mod layout. This forces me to change 40+ mod orders all over again every time I load a new mod. Is there a setting to disable auto sorting?

Additionally, I find that although I have saved a mod profile, every time I play the game, it defaults to its pre-defined order right before startup. Is this by design?

I agree with ARmodder. I have used this version of the Bohemia ArmA 3 Launcher since it was first released, and it has always remembered the mod order.

If that is giving you a problem, then I would suggest you arrange your mods in the order you want them then select "More" from the menu above and export your mod file list. That way if your launcher has not remembered your mod order you won't have to select 40+ mods, you just need to import your mod list.
